Waking up next to a dead FBI agent and a briefcase full of money, and with flashbacks to his combat training, Jake suspects he's actually an undercover operative. He comes into contact with numerous characters who add to his confusion: Diane (Nicollette Sheridan), a blond bombshell claiming to be his wife; Gina (Lucy Liu), a feisty waitress who insists she's his girlfriend; and employees of a computer technology company who are adamant that he's a janitor. The film escalates into a race against the clock--while piecing his past together Jake realizes he holds a valuable secret and must thwart a group of dangerous agents who are after him. Reviews for Code Name: The Cleaner
It's a bad sign for a comedy when viewers are left pining for more ineptly staged shoot-'em-up sequences.
Hollywood certainly didn't waste anytime in turning out its first insulting blaxploitation flick of 2007.
It's Memento for dummies. But to this movie's credit, I couldn't follow it, either.
The Entertainer conjures up some charm, and DeRay Davis provides pyrotechnics as a janitor/wanna-be rapper, but like the teddy-clad bubble-bath square-off between Liu and Sheridan, it’s just not enough.
Cedric's style of humor seems to be stating the obvious, but doing it really fast. He mumbles out loud and makes lame observations.
too clumsy to be the sophisticated parody of memory-loss films it might have been, too bland for its action sequences to kick any ass, too dumbed-down to make much out of the clashes of race, class and gender at the heart of its fish-out-of-water comedy
There's some pretty good improvised shtick from DeRay Davis as a wacky janitor. But these are small pleasures in a movie that never really generates any serious laughs.
A bunch of small disasters, collected together and fed to Cedric the Entertainer.
The outtakes in the closing credits were the funniest parts of the movie.
[A] cheerfully dumb spy comedy filled with ridiculous stereotypes and plot holes as big as cartoon anvils.
Somewhere, John Candy and Chris Farley are high-fivin' each other that they died before headlining this stinker.
Although comprised of lowest-common denominator gags, it’s an oddly hard-to-follow affair, with good and bad FBI agents popping up everywhere and the plot only revealing itself in fits and starts.
A faux thriller plot has something to do with a stolen computer chip. The chip isn't the only thing missing from this tepid concoction. You may be hard pressed to find real laughs, with Cedric proving more affable than funny.
The idea is that given the basic premise, the comedian will fill in the gaps with his own bits of business. Cedric is hardly up to the task. Though he's a scene stealer in other people's movies, he relies on tired reactions ("heeellll naw" is his mantra).
